He's Officialy Ours!!

We had court this morning and it was a whirlwind! Fastest court I have ever been to.....! Our translator is so very good at what she does, she's super confident and sweet! She and our driver were very reassuring before we went into court. Chris did a fabulous job answering so many of the questions. He really had the lion's share of them. I probably had about 5 questions total. The judge was very serious and you could tell she has the children's best interest at heart. Yet, her eyes were kind and it was somehow very reassuring as well. She was speaking super fast, and it was difficult for our translator to keep up with her... so much so that at the end when we were asked if we agree with her verdict... we had no idea if the verdict was Yes or not! lol! We could tell by the smile on our translators face that it was... and she nodded her head and of course we agreed. lol! And that was our time in court. I am so glad it was first thing in the morning, as I would not have wanted to wait all day.

After court we drove to the orphanage and they got our little guy ready to go out.... not because the 10 days was waived.. It wasn't. But we had to get his passport photo taken. Poor guy, he was definitely scared and cranky as it was his naptime. I wouldn't have wanted to go out in the cold either! It's funny because he cries when he has to take off his snow jacket, hat and scarf. Putting it on is no big deal. It took him a little bit to warm up to us.... he didn't want to come to me, but the caregiver kind of guided him over and I scooped him up as I knew we had to get moving!

He did great in the car, though we brought airplane bags just in case. He was fine! Just sat in my lap and watched the traffic. He was definitely tired and definitely unsure! We got the pictures accomplished and then went back to the orphanage where he cried again to have his hat and jacket and scarf taken off. Poor guy! After that Chris got him to warm up to us pretty well! Just silly daddy stuff! You could see his face not wanting to smile, but as Chris is pretty tireless in the silly daddy antics he got some smiles, then giggles, then outright laughs from him! lol!

We came home and crashed, then grabbed a bite to eat at the Hard Rock Cafe. Then Chris took me to the really nice grocery store... and boy was it really nice! Ummm I mean I'm calling it the Gucci grocery store from now on.... I do believe we may actually buy a few things from there next time. Like maybe one berry for 100 rubles. lol! We figured out a pint of Hagen Daz ice cream was close to $15.00. Like I said the most expensive city in Europe... no wonder we are flying home in between trips!

Tomorrow we get to visit the orphanage again and our count of days starts then. So, after tomorrow there are 9 left. We fly back out on Sunday afternoon, very early Sunday morning EST. I'll be glad to get back home, but it's gonna be another whirlwind trip! This next one though, we are bringing home the best Christmas gift ever!
